Shah Rukh Khan 



Biography Profile Biodata

Shah Rukh Khan, also known as SRK, is an Indian film actor, producer and television personality. Designated in the media as the "Bollywood Badshah", "King of Bollywood", "King Khan", he has appeared in more than 80 Bollywood films, and has received numerous awards, including 14 Filmfare Awards. Khan has a large client base in Asia and the Indian diaspora worldwide. In terms of audience size and revenue, he has been described as one of the most successful movie stars in the world.

Khan was born on November 2, 1965 in a Muslim family in New Delhi.  He spent the first five years of his life in Mangalore, where his maternal grandfather, Ifthikar Ahmed, was chief engineer of the port in the 1960s.According to Khan, his paternal grandfather, Jan Muhammad, a Pashtun of ethnic origin, was from Afghanistan. Khan's father, Meer Taj Mohammed Khan, was an Indian independence activist in Peshawar, British India. In 2010, Khan's paternal family was still living in the Shah Wali Qataal area, in the Qissa Khawani bazaar in Peshawar . Meer was a disciple of Khan Abdul Ghaffar Khan,  and affiliated with the All Indian National Congress.

Career

Khan's first leading role was in Lekh Tandon's Dil Dariya television series, which began shooting in 1988, but production delays led to the 1989 Fauji series becoming its television debut instead. In the series, which portrays a realistic look at army cadet training, he plays the lead role of Abhimanyu Rai.  This led to further appearances in Aziz Mirza's television series Circus and Mani Kaul's mini-series Idiot .

Khan also played minor roles in soap operas Umeed  and Wagle Ki Duniya ,as well as in the English television movie In Which Annie Gives It Ones .  His appearances in these soap operas led critics to compare his look and style with those of actor Dilip Kumar, but Khan was not interested in cinema at the time, thinking he was not good enough.

Khan's only exit in 1999 was Baadshah, in which he played in front of Twinkle Khanna. Although the film underperformed at the box office,  it earned him a Filmfare Award nomination for Best Performance in a Comedy Role, which he lost to Govinda for Haseena Maan Jaayegi. Khan became a producer in 1999 in collaboration with actress Juhi Chawla and director Aziz Mirza for a production company called Dreamz Unlimited. The company's first production, Phir Bhi Dil Hai Hindustani ,with Khan and Chawla, was a commercial failure.

After declining the role of Anil Kapoor in Danny Boyle's Slumdog Millionaire, Khan began filming My Name Is Khan, his fourth collaboration with director Karan Johar and his sixth with Kajol. The film is based on a true story and fits into the context of Islam's perceptions after 9/11. Khan plays Rizwan Khan, a Muslim suffering from Asperger's Syndrome who travels across America to meet the country's president, in a role that film specialist Stephen Teo sees as a "symbol of assertive rasa values." Khan co-produced three films from 1999 to 2003 as a founding member of the Dreamz Unlimited partnership.After the dissolution of the partnership, Gauri and he restructured the company as Red Chillies Entertainment, which includes divisions responsible for film and television production, visual effects and advertising.In 2015, the company produced or co-produced at least nine films.

In 2008, Khan, in partnership with Juhi Chawla and her husband Jay Mehta, acquired the property rights for the Kolkata franchise in the Twenty20 Indian Premier League  cricket tournament for 75.09 million and appointed Kolkata Knight Riders Team . In 2009, KKR was one of the richest IPL teams with a brand value of 42.1 million.


Interesting Facts

  • He was born into a middle-class family; his father used to run a transport company and his mother was a magistrate.

  • He told an interview that his mother was a South-Indian and belonged to Andhra Pradesh, who later moved to Karnataka.

  • He was named Shahrukh, which means “Face of the King,” but he prefers to write his name as Shah Rukh Khan.

  • He has an immense love for video games.

  • He was awarded the ‘Sword of Honor’ title at St. Columba’s School, New Delhi, which was assigned to the best student of the school.

  • He was first offered a role in Lekh Tandon’s television show “Dil Dariya,” but there were continuous delays in the broadcasting of the show, which led his series “Fauji” to become his television debut.

  • He got his first offer in Hema Malini‘s directional debut “Dil Aashna Hai,” but he made his acting debut with “Deewana,” which was released in June 1992.

  • He founded the Meer Foundation (NGO), which works to rehabilitate burn and acid attack survivors and empower women in India in 2013.
